Overview
Universal Robots (UR) is a global leader in collaborative robots (cobots) designed to work safely and efficiently alongside humans. These robots are adaptable, easy to program, and ideal for automating repetitive, hazardous, or intricate tasks. UR cobots are widely used in industries such as manufacturing, automotive, electronics, and food processing to increase productivity, improve safety, and reduce operational costs.
Detailed Feature List with Use Cases
- Ease of Programming
- Intuitive programming interface with a teach pendant or drag-and-drop software.
- Use Case: Quickly reprogram robots for new tasks without specialized expertise.
- Safety Features
- Built-in force and torque sensors for safe human-robot collaboration.
- Use Case: Use cobots in assembly lines without safety cages.
- Versatility
- Compatible with a wide range of end-effectors (grippers, cameras, sensors).
- Use Case: Deploy cobots for tasks like pick-and-place, welding, and quality inspection.
- Compact and Lightweight Design
- Easy to deploy and relocate within facilities.
- Use Case: Move cobots between production lines as needed.
- High Precision and Repeatability
- Delivers consistent performance for precision tasks.
- Use Case: Use cobots for intricate assembly or soldering tasks.
- Scalability
- Modular design allows for easy scaling of automation solutions.
- Use Case: Start with one cobot and expand as production needs grow.
- Integration with Existing Systems
- Seamlessly integrates with PLCs, vision systems, and other factory equipment.
- Use Case: Automate material handling in a fully connected production line.
- Energy Efficiency
- Low power consumption compared to traditional industrial robots.
- Use Case: Reduce energy costs in high-volume production environments.
- Remote Monitoring and Control
- Monitor and control cobots remotely via cloud-based platforms.
- Use Case: Manage multiple cobots across different facilities from a single dashboard.

Comparison with Competitors
Feature | Universal Robots | ABB Yumi | FANUC CR Series | KUKA LBR iiwa |
Ease of Programming | ✅ | ✅ | ❌ | ✅ |
Safety Features | ✅ | ✅ | ✅ | ✅ |
Versatility | ✅ | ✅ | ✅ | ✅ |
Payload Capacity | Up to 16 kg | Up to 0.5 kg (dual-arm) | Up to 35 kg | Up to 14 kg |
Integration | ✅ | ✅ | ✅ | ✅ |
Pricing | 25,000−25,000−50,000 | 40,000−40,000−60,000 | 50,000−50,000−80,000 | 60,000−60,000−100,000 |
Best For | Small to medium-sized tasks | Precision assembly | Heavy payload tasks | High-precision tasks |
